Meaning of MILFOIL in Punjabi
Use in sentences of MILFOIL
Meaning of MILFOIL in English
- A common composite herb (Achillea Millefolium) with white flowers and finely dissected leaves; yarrow.
Articles Related to ‘MILFOIL’
ਅੱਖਰਾਂ 'ਤੇ ਕਲਿੱਕ ਕਰਕੇ ਹੋਰ ਸ਼ਬਦ ਵੇਖੋ